Texas A&M continued its hot streak on Thursday night, handling the Bulldogs with ease. Freshman Braden Shewmake launched a grand slam in the fourth, and ace Brigham Hill provided seven solid innings of work in the victory.

Tennessee's Hunter Martin dominated the Aggie bats for most of Friday's afternoon contest, but Braden Shewmake and George Janca came up with timely hits to push Texas A&M past the Vols. Brigham Hill threw seven scoreless innings in the win.

Auburn ace Casey Mize put on a show at Olsen Field on Friday night, striking out 12 batters. Texas A&M hitters spent the night baffled and failed to capitalize on their few opportunities in another SEC loss at home.

Nothing seemed to work for Texas A&M in its series-opening loss to Kentucky on Friday. Brigham Hill and Kaylor Chafin turned in lukewarm performances on the mound, and the Aggie bats were silenced by Wildcat ace Sean Hjelle.

Though none of the Aggie pitchers brought their best games to Olsen on Friday, Texas A&M defeated Brown on the back of an explosive second inning and some timely defensive gems. Brigham Hill improved to 4-0 on the year with the victory.
